Object Number 95-21-10/4870
Display Title Ceramic vessel, painted
Descriptions
Object Description Small ceramic jug - “combination lost color and direct painting”
Inventory Description Earthenware vessel with a round base and red and white painting on exterior, neck broken
Classification
  • Complete Vessel
Department Archaeological
Geography/Provenience/Site Name
North America / United States / Missouri / <County> / <City> / Burial Mounds
Intrasite Mound XVI
Additional Geographic Terms Southeast
Materials Ceramic
Dimensions Overall: 8.1 × 10.3 × 10.1 cm (3 3/16 × 4 1/16 × 4 in.)
Quantity 1
Label on object Mo. Mound. XVI.; 430.; 4870#
Provenance
Collector Prof. W. B. Potter (01/01/1876-01/01/1878)
Collector Dr. George J. Engelmann (01/01/1876-01/01/1878)
Donor Dr. George J. Engelmann (01/01/1895)
